What does the associative property state?

The associative property is a math rule that says that the way in which factors are grouped in a multiplication problem does not change the product.

What are examples of the associative property?

Associative property of addition: Changing the grouping of addends does not change the sum. What is the formula for associative property?

The formula for the associative property of multiplication is (a × b) × c = a × (b × c). This formula tells us that no matter how the brackets are placed in a multiplication expression, the product of the numbers remains the same.

What is associative property 3rd grade?

This property states that when three or more numbers are added (or multiplied), the sum (or the product) is the same regardless of the grouping of the addends (or the multiplicands). Associative property involves 3 or more numbers.

What is associate associative property?

To “associate” means to connect or join with something. According to the associative property of multiplication, the product of three or more numbers remains the same regardless of how the numbers are grouped.

How do you find associative property?

The associative property always involves 3 or more numbers. The numbers grouped within a parenthesis, are terms in the expression that considered as one unit. There is also an associative property of multiplication. However, subtraction and division are not associative.

How do you explain associative property to a child?

The associative property says that when we add or multiply numbers it doesn’t matter how we group them. This rule applies to numbers that are grouped within brackets, for example: 2 + (3 + 4) or 5 x (2 x 3).

What is the commutative property of addition with example?

Likewise, the commutative property of additionstates that when two numbers are being added, their order can be changed without affecting the sum. For example, 30 + 25 has the same sum as 25 + 30. 30 + 25 = 55
